I am Anushree. I grew up in a town called Jamalpur from the state of Bihar in India. I cleared an examination to pursue graduation from one of the top ranked university of the country- Jawaharlal Nehru University, New Delhi.

For my master’s degree I received the Erasmus Mundus Scholarship by the European Commission for a joint master degree programme and pursued studies in England, Norway and Germany. My thesis research study focused on gender roles in ethnic communities. Later, I also received Women Empowerment Scholarship for Developing nations by the ‘Intern Group’ and did an internship in Madrid, Spain.

I am a social development practitioner and have experiences of working with national and international organizations like United Nations Development Programme (UNDP), Aga Khan Rural Support Programme (AKRSP), ASHOKA (Spain), Ministry of Youth Affairs & Sports etc.

Within my limited experience, I have worked across diverse geographies and have a deep interest in the political, social and economic aspects of the development sector. My work experience comprises attaining SDGs though strategic planning, developing DPRs for poverty reduction and value chain creation- for regions affected by poor socio-economic indicators. Both my passion and motivation is to work in challenging and hard-to-reach geographical locations, majorly affected by poverty, conflict and basic amenities of life.

I am also an adventure enthusiast and a certified (advance degree) mountaineer. I have been part of and also led expeditions in Himalayas and in Alps. My associations with mountains and nature as a whole, and the issues of climate change becoming a critical problem in past two decades has recently sharpened my desire to work for environmental programmes.
